Join Barbara Dahlstedt, award-winning colored pencil artist, as she introduces three days of colored pencil techniques. Each day artists will create a different subject on a variety of drawing surfaces. Discover that exquisite detail is possible with the fine tip of a colored pencil. Realistic birds, animals, and flowers can be created with a mere flick of the wrist. Barbara will share time-saving strategies along with step-by-step instruction, reference photos, and three different drawing surfaces. High-quality colored pencils are clean, dynamic, and easy to use. In fact, colored pencil just may become your favorite fine art medium!

Barbara Dahlstedt

Barbara Dahlstedt

Barbara is an award-winning, Signature member of the Colored Pencil Society of America and American Women Artists. She earned a Bachelor of Fine Arts Degree from Arizona State University and has a Master’s Degree in Curriculum and Instruction. After enjoying a twenty-six-year career teaching high school art, Barbara continues to share her passion for art through teaching workshops and online classes.  Her drawings have won top awards in many local and international competitions and can be found in several publications including International Artists Magazine, Artists Magazine, Art Collector, Strokes of Genius, and Colored Pencil Magazine.

Materials List

If you are new to colored pencil, colors can be ordered individually or a Prismacolor Premier set of 150 may be purchased at most art stores which includes all colors used in the workshop. Please note that one Holbein brand pencil (Soft White) is also used in each project. The instructor will provide the drawing paper and photo references.

Day 1: PARROT

Prismacolor Pencils:

White, Cream, Lemon Yellow, Canary Yellow, Spanish Orange, Pale Vermillion, Permanent Red, Crimson Lake, Henna, Dahlia Purple, Black Cherry, Black Grape, Dioxazine Purple, Indanthrone Blue, Copenhagen Blue, Yellow Chartreuse, Chartreuse, Spring Green, True Green, Olive Green, Dark Green, Black

Colorless Blender

Holbein Pencil: Soft White

Other Supplies Pencil Sharpener Kneaded Eraser Painter’s Tape

Day 2: CAT

Prismacolor Pencils:

White, 20% French Grey, 30% French Grey, 50% French Grey, 30% Warm Grey, 50% Warm Grey, 70% Warm Grey, 50% Cool Grey, 70% Cool Grey, Beige Sienna, Henna, Burnt Ochre, Sienna Brown, Terra Cotta, Black Cherry, Dark Umber, Copenhagen Blue,  Black

Holbein Pencil: Soft White

Other Supplies Pencil Sharpener, MonoZero Eraser (round), Painter’s Tape, Slice Tool

Day 3: FLOWER

Prismacolor Pencils:

White, Copenhagen Blue, Indanthrone Blue, Denim Blue, China Blue, Chartreuse, 20% Warm Grey, Yellow Ochre, Olive Green, Dioxazine Purple, Sienna Brown, Sepia, Black

Holbein Pencil: Soft White

Other Supplies Pencil Sharpener, Kneaded Eraser, Ball Point Pen, Small flat watercolor brush (1/4-1/2 inch wide), Painter’s Tape, Blending Stump, Slice Tool
